On 12/26/25 12:18, Sergey Kaplun wrote:
> This patch adjusts the aforementioned test to use the benchmark
> framework introduced before. The default arguments are adjusted
> according to the <PARAM_x86.txt> file. The arguments to the script still
> can be provided in the command line run.
>
> The input for the test is redirected from the generated file
> <SUMCOL_5000.txt>. This file is the result of concatenation of the
> <SUMCOL_1.txt> 5000 times.

> diff --git a/perf/LuaJIT-benches/sum-file.lua b/perf/LuaJIT-benches/sum-file.lua
> index c9e618fd..6af2b4a5 100644
> --- a/perf/LuaJIT-benches/sum-file.lua
> +++ b/perf/LuaJIT-benches/sum-file.lua
> @@ -1,6 +1,29 @@
> +-- The benchmark to check the performance of reading lines from
> +-- stdin and sum the given numbers (the strings converted to
> +-- numbers by the VM automatically).
>
> -local sum = 0
> -for line in io.lines() do
> - sum = sum + line
> -end
> -io.write(sum, "\n")
> +local bench = require("bench").new(arg)
> +
> +-- XXX: The input file is generated from <SUMCOL_1.txt> by
> +-- repeating it 5000 times. The <SUMCOL_1.txt> contains 1000 lines
> +-- with the total sum of 500.
> +bench:add({
> + name = "sum_file",
> + payload = function()
> + local sum = 0
> + for line in io.lines() do
> + sum = sum + line
> + end
> + -- Allow several iterations.
> +io.stdin:seek("set", 0)
> + return sum
> + end,
> + checker = function(res)
> + -- Precomputed result.
> + return res == 2500000
> + end,
> + -- Fixed size of the file.
> + items = 5e6,
> +})
> +
> +bench:run_and_report()
